#44614a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#44614a is composed of 26.7% red, 38%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.7%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 132.4 degrees, a saturation of 17.6% and a lightness of 32.4%. #44614a color hex could be obtained by blending #88c294 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#44614a color description : Very dark grayish lime green.
#44614a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#44614a has RGB values of R:68, G:97, B:74 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 4481354.

Shades and Tints of #44614a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030504 is the darkest color, while #f8faf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#44614a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#515451 is the less saturated color, while #05a025 is the most saturated one.
